Summary Operating under the direction of the Building Leader and classroom teachers, this position provides instructional support with a focus on delivering reading interventions using Colorado Department of Education (CDE)�approved programs. This position supports implementation of the READ Act by assisting with intervention lesson delivery, preparing instructional materials, monitoring student progress, and reinforcing positive learning behaviors. This position also contributes to assessment logistics, clerical tasks, and the maintenance of an organized, supportive intervention environment. Instructional and READ Act Support Assist the teacher in delivering intervention lessons using CDE-approved instructional programs. Support small-group and individual instruction in reading skills, literacy foundations, and targeted interventions. Reinforce teacher expectations by coaching and guiding students during learning activities. Monitor student participation, engagement, and progress; communicate updates to teachers and building leadership. Collaborate with teachers and administrators to identify students who may require additional reading intervention support. Participate in required staff meetings, intervention training, and building-level professional development. 2. Clerical Support Assist with clerical tasks such as scheduling intervention sessions and supporting assessment logistics. Prepare, organize, and maintain intervention records and student documentation as directed. 3. Instructional Materials Support Prepare, copy, and organize instructional and intervention materials. Assist with tracking, reviewing, and recording student assignments and intervention activities. Support classroom organization by maintaining materials, tools, and resources used for intervention programs. 4.
